Zero-downtime migrations for Glintbase plugins: ship schema changes in two releases. Release one adds columns and dual-writes; release two drops old paths. Never rename in place. The Marrowtide migration runner validates your manifest against the live schema before applying anything, and it refuses to run unannounced DDL. Runner access is gated per plugin; request credentials through the Fernhollow portal. Once approved, put the runner's auth secret on the next line of your plugin's env file.

sealed setting: ARCHIVE_KEY3=8d0

After flashing firmware 3.2 to the Verdanix controller, run the drift-correction pass before enabling automation. Field units in the Tarlow installations showed humidity sensors drifting +4% per month, so the controller now applies a rolling baseline from the reference probe. Support staff: if a grower reports erratic misting, check that CALIBRATION_WINDOW=72h is set in the controller env file. The correction service also reports readings to the Verdanix cloud, which requires its upload credential on the next line.

env line for fafof-fahag: LEDGER_TOKEN5=f8790

## Approvals: Upload Encoding Detection

Scope: Varrowfile's text upload pipeline. Detection order: BOM check, UTF-8 validation, then heuristic fallback capped at 64 KB sampled. Non-conforming files are rejected, not transcoded silently. Any change to detection order, confidence thresholds, or the fallback charset list requires an approved review. Reviewers: verify no path writes undetected bytes to storage and that rejection logging omits file contents. Changes to this page or the pipeline config need approval from the owner named below.

account owner for kafop-haweg: Pelax Gilael Istir

Cron-to-workflow migration, account recovery. Context: legacy cron jobs on Hollowmere boxes are being moved into the Tidewheel workflow engine. During cutover, the migration service account may lock if both schedulers fire simultaneously and exhaust auth retries. Steps: disable the legacy crontab first, confirm no duplicate runs in the Tidewheel UI, then clear the lockout flag on the service account. Re-enable workflows one at a time. Recovery console access requires the passphrase below.

unlock words, yawig-kagef: gordor-holvan-ulaael-pramir-ulaiel-tamdor